Package: xfig
Version: 1:3.2.5-alpha5-7
Severity: normal
xfig seems to have lpr as hard-coded print command. This will fail
to work if CUPS is installed without the cupsys-bsd package (in
which case 'lp' is the print command, not 'lpr'). I suggest using lp
if present (that should also work with BSD printing, since Xfig does
not print pure text), and falling back to lpr.
If that's not possible, please suggest
cupsys-bsd | lpd | lprng
If it is possible, I think you might also want to suggest the
printing commands, but as
cupsys-client | cupsys-bsd | lpd | lprng

Changes:
xfig (1:3.2.5-alpha5-8) unstable; urgency=low
.
* 13_remove_extra_libs.dpatch: Remove unnecessary dependencies on libz,
libXmu, libSM, libICE, and libXext.
* 14_manpage_fixsyntax.dpatch: Fix a nroff syntax error in man page.
* 15_lp_or_lpr.dpatch: Use lp if available or fall back to lpr
(Closes: #384330).
* 16_man_rigidtext.dpatch: document X resource .rigidtext in man page
(Closes: #338544).
* 17_numfracts.dpatch: Fix NUM_FRACTS otherwise the for loop will
overrun. Thanks to Eric Sharkey <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> for mentioning
this and providing a fix (Closes: #308527).
